This beautiful barn conversion is part of Oak Tree Farm which dates back to 1812. It has been superbly renovated by its owners to provide spacious and comfortable holiday accommodation. Step inside into the modern farmhouse kitchen with its large oak dresser and range cooker, stylish fixtures and smart accessories. Whether it’s casual dining and a glass of wine at the breakfast bar, or more formal dining in the conservatory, this property caters to your every need. In the summer months eat breakfast alfresco on the patio and enjoy the surrounding countryside and open views. The open plan living area makes the perfect place to unwind after a day of exploring with its attractive décor and comfortable furnishings. A large wood burner is the focal point and on winter nights makes for a cosy stay.

This luxury property is situated in the picturesque village of West Witton, within walking distance of the village store and tearooms. With its highly acclaimed restaurant, The Wensleydale Heiffer, just a short stroll away, this makes a perfect choice for a special celebration.

Turn in either direction out of the Barn at Oak Tree farm and you’ll be spoilt for choice. With walks direct from the doorstep and wall to wall views, this is such a pretty area. Cycling is extremely popular here, being stage to the Tour de France and the annual Tour de Yorkshire.

Travel to Aysgarth to see the waterfalls or visit Hawes and its quirky shops and cafés, not forgetting to stop off at the famous Wensleydale Creamery. In the opposite direction you will pass the picturesque village of Middleham and its famous castle, enjoy the sights as the race horses’ ride to and from the gallops each day, or sit it in the village square and enjoy a coffee as you watch the world go by.

A little further and you will reach the bustling market town of Leyburn with its host of interesting shops, restaurants and cafés, all set around the market square, and of course Friday is market day and a good chance to snap up some of the gorgeous local produce. Shop, pub and restaurant ¼ mile.

    A lovely cottage in a good location but in need of a bit of general maintenance / TLC - the blind in one bedroom is broken, the stair carpet has a hole in and the window in the main bedroom has a broken catch so does not close. This was reported after a draughty first night and a temporary fix was done. The owner said the window company had been contacted but nothing could be done the week we were staying. Hopefully this has can be rectified for the next guests. It would have been nice if the cobwebs in the bathroom and kitchen had been removed and the crumbs in the kitchen cupboards and wine rack had been cleaned. The kitchen cupboard doors would also have benefited from a wipe. The For Sale sign that was put up just before we left perhaps explains the comments above.Having said all of that, we had some lovely walks from the cottage and enjoyed a couple of good meals at The Fox.

    Lovely barn conversation overlooking a field at rear, which had pheasants and occasional hare in it. Very comfortable place and convenient for village via path opposite house. Probably wouldn’t recommend for small children as the entrance is onto busy road on bad bend. We really enjoyed our stay. Ate in Fox and Hounds in village (friendly and decent food) The Saddle Room ( classy but not expensive) and 3 Horse Shoes ( tasty food)
